A car crashed on Mumbai’s Coastal Road early Sunday morning.

Four people were inside the car.

The car was travelling from Marine Drive toward Haji Ali.

Police said it may have been speeding when the driver lost control.

It hit a wall and fell into a construction area.

Three people died, including a 17-year-old.

One person, Aditya Oswal, was badly injured and is being treated.

Police are still investigating what happened, including whether anyone was intoxicated.

Key facts

Deaths
Three of the four occupants were declared brought dead.
Injured
Aditya Oswal, 23, is critically injured and receiving treatment at Nair Hospital.
Identified deceased
Shanay Gajjal, 21, and Dhirya Seth, 17.
Vehicle
A black BMW.
Crash time
Approximately 5:20 a.m. on Sunday.
Crash location
Near Lotus Jetty, opposite Lala College, on Mumbai’s Coastal Road.
Investigation
Police are investigating; intoxication has not been determined.

Quotes

Meena Jagtap

Senior Police Inspector speaking about the Mumbai Coastal Road crash

“At around 5:20 a.m., a black BMW was travelling from Marine Drive towards Haji Ali in the northbound direction when it fell from the Coastal Road. There were four people in the car. Three people died, while Aditya is currently at Nair Hospital.”
